By train
Train is the obvious option for arrival, as
Shinjuku Station is on the
JR Yamanote, Chuo, Sobu, and Saikyo lines. The Keio and Odakyu private
railways stop here as well. If that isn't enough there are the Metro
Marunouchi, Toei Shinjuku and Toei O-Edo lines here as well. By some
measures this is the busiest railway station in the world; try to
board the Marunouchi towards Tokyo Station at 8 AM on a Monday morning
if you doubt this.
There is also Narita Express train and limousine bus service to and
from Narita Airport.
By bus
Not a few highway buses for points throughout Japan depart from the
bus station near the east exit (opposite Yodobashi), most notably
those heading to Mount Fuji.
